    • A data processing part in a printer controller performs multivalued dither processing whereby image data is processed for images of characters and thin lines with a high definition, and for pictures with a high color gradation, and the image quality deterioration at the boundary region between an edge region and a non-edge region can be avoided. The data processing part performs discrimination of an edge region, a non-edge region, and a boundary region between the edge and non-edge regions. Furthermore, the data processing part performs multivalued dither processing by using a prepared dot distribution type dither matrix for the edge region, a prepared dot concentration type dither matrix for the non-edge region and a prepared dot distribution and concentration mixing type dither matrix for the boundary region. Furthermore, the amount of image data to be processed is reduced by dividing an image frame into a plurality of pixel blocks and expressing an image of each pixel block with a few of approximate color data and approximate color arrangement data.

    • A mobile device for an X-ray apparatus is formed of a freely rotatable hollow column disposed on a mobile base, a holding section for holding an X-ray tube in a vertical direction along the column, and a counter weight connected through a wire to the holding section to be suspended inside the column. A column rotating section formed of a bearing portion and a rotational shaft with a hollow part is disposed in the mobile base. A lower part of the counter weight is provided with a convex portion which enters into the hollow part of the rotational shaft. When the holding section for the X-ray tube is elevated to the highest point, the counter weight is lowered to the lowest point, wherein the convex portion of the counter weight enters into the hollow part of the rotational shaft. Thus, a volume of the hollow part can be utilized as a part of the volume of the counter weight to allow the counter weight to be made of iron and the like, other than lead.

    • An image signal processing apparatus to realize signal processing system and apparatus constitution, where an image signal inputted using a photoelectric conversion element such as a CCD or a contact type image sensor is obtained in circuit constitution of small scale with high picture quality. In order to solve the problems, data width of a signal referred to in a shading corrector, an MTF corrector and an error diffusion circuit is made b+f+j.ltoreq.8 per one pixel. Or error component commonly possessed by plural pixels (N pixels) in the error diffusion circuit is made b+f+j'.ltoreq.8, data width per one pixel being made j'=j/N. Image signal processing is realized in this constitution, thereby data width of a signal referred to in respective signal processings is reduced, and an image signal satisfying accuracy of signal processing sufficiently and having high picture quality can be obtained. For example, when a circuit is constituted by LSI, the memory section can be easily mounted on the same LSI. A memory required in the image signal processing can be made 8 bits per one pixel and a cheap memory constitution can be utilized.

    • A hollow weather strip which is excellent in an external appearance is provided. The weather strip comprises an extrusion portion having a given width, a mold portion connected to an end side of said extrusion portion. The mold portion has a slot at a back surface thereof and has a width which is larger than the width of the extrusion portion by a width of the slit. The extrusion portion has a substantially V-shape spread slit provided on an end back surface thereof, and the slit is continuous from the slot and is consecutively reduced in a width as said V-shaped spread slit recedes from a position where the extrusion portion and the mold portion are connected to each other.
